Output 56a3059a743ede8f0e8ed40d7c009180deda5a658d7feb1c9548d1e4e46fd3e7:0

value
64703820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c246a50bb7f61adfee694263e8454731354827 OP_EQUAL
address
3DhhBCmAQrPBbWwWax9eLpoPV56m1Y4K7f
transaction
56a3059a743ede8f0e8ed40d7c009180deda5a658d7feb1c9548d1e4e46fd3e7
spent
true